Teacher's perceptions, institutional challenges, and educational sustainability during Covid-19 in Ecuador Lucy Andrade-Vargas*, Artieres Estevao-Romeiro", Margoth Iriarte-Solano"


Abstract:

The Covid-19 pandemic has affected global educational systems, especially in developing countries. Therefore, governments and educational administrators have adopted contingency measures to maintain the functioning and the sustainability of their national educational systems. These measures involved the use of technologies and have enabled a significant amount of teachers to continue working with their students around the globe. This article aims to analyze the perception of Ecuadorian teachers about the contingency measures taken at the governmental and institutional levels while facing the COVID-19 crisis. Also, several aspects regarding the teachers' perceptions about their technological skills, access to electronic devices, and implications of teleworking in their mental health and performance are also analyzed.
